Description
– A high-polished welded chain conforming to DIN766 standards is a type of chain known for its smooth, reflective surface and its use in various applications, particularly those requiring a strong and corrosion-resistant chain.
– DIN 766 specifically refers to a standard for short link calibrated chain, often used in anchor systems for boats and other marine applications.
Key Features:
Material:
Typically made from stainless steel (like SS304, SS316, or SS316L) for corrosion resistance and durability, or high carbon steel or mild steel.
Finish:
The “high polished” finish enhances its appearance, provides a smooth surface, and can also offer some additional protection against corrosion.
DIN 766 Standard:
This standard specifies the dimensions and specifications for a short link calibrated chain, ensuring consistent link size and suitability for specific applications like windlasses (devices for raising and lowering anchors).
Welded Construction:
The links are welded together for increased strength and reliability.
Applications:
Commonly used in marine environments for anchor systems, but also suitable for other applications requiring a strong, corrosion-resistant, and aesthetically pleasing chain.
Customization:
Can be available in various sizes (e.g., 2mm to 30mm) and potentially in different materials to suit specific needs.
Quality and Safety:
Meets international standards (like DIN766) and is often proof load tested to ensure quality and safety.
